The core feature of an RN to BSN online no clinicals program is the waiver of traditional, hands-on clinical placements. Many RNs wonder how this is possible and if it compromises the quality of education. The answer lies in the program’s design, which recognizes the extensive clinical experience that licensed RNs already possess. Instead of repeating basic patient care rotations, these programs focus on advancing knowledge in areas that build upon existing skills.

To fulfill the experiential component of the degree without traditional clinicals, programs employ alternative methods. These may include capstone projects, where a student designs and proposes a solution to a real-world problem in their current workplace; community health assessments conducted through data analysis; or sophisticated virtual simulations that present complex patient scenarios for critical decision-making. These approaches validate and apply the theoretical knowledge gained in the coursework directly to the RN’s professional context.

When considering any nursing program, accreditation is the most critical factor for ensuring quality and credibility. For RN to BSN programs, the key accrediting body is the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E) or the Accreditation Commission for Education in Nursing (ACEN). Attending an accredited program is essential because it guarantees that the education meets national standards, is recognized by employers, and makes a nurse eligible for future graduate studies. Always verify a school’s accreditation status before applying.

Earning a BSN is more than just a personal achievement; it is a response to a national call for a more highly educated nursing workforce. The Institute of Medicine’s landmark report on the Future of Nursing recommended that 80% of the nursing workforce hold a BSN by 2020, a goal that hospitals and health systems are still striving to meet through hiring preferences and internal promotion policies. An RN with a BSN is often preferred for specialized nursing roles, charge nurse positions, and management tracks. Furthermore, a BSN is a prerequisite for admission into Master of Science in Nursing (MSN) and Doctor of Nursing Practice (DNP) programs, which open doors to advanced practice roles like Nurse Practitioner, Nurse Anesthetist, and Nurse Executive.
